> > > You can find out for yourself. Browse the market with a G1 and check
> > > the number of downloads of some of the at-price apps that compare to
> > > your friend's vision apps and that have been made available for
> > > download for a few weeks now. This would be a 15 to 30 minute exercise
> > > that will give you the business intel you are looking for. Then assume
> > > a return rate, deduct Google's 30% cut from the revenue. You're friend
> > > will now the applicable taxes, ODC etc.
> > > This will be an order of magnitude estimate only, but should be
> > > accurate enough to arrive at a conclusion.
